Doesn’t time fly when you’re having fun! Can’t believe another year with Cilcain has gone by already. We’ve had another successful year in the club, participating in competitions and events across the county and Wales. In addition to this we have also built on our membership numbers and gained several new members who are now all well involved in the group.
Throughout the year the club has welcomed a number of guest speakers ranging from a Citizens Advice Bureau to the British Heart Foundation to a wild zumba dancing teacher! We’ve also gone on a variety of trips out including go-karting, Patchwork Pate, Crocky Trail and of course the trip to Paris in February! This was a trip enjoyed thoroughly by all members who attended and I don’t think we’ve ever fitted in so much in such a short space of time!
Before we knew it was the annual Cilcain Bonfire night held on the field! As always this was a success and provided us with £1753.00, enough money to cover our costs for the year. However, it’s not all good news. Last September we were all given the devastating news that our Vice President, Dave Roberts had sadly passed away. Following this terrible loss we decided that our chosen charity for the Harvest Festival would be the Stroke Ward 14 in Glan Clwyd Hospital. The Harvest Festival was very well attended and raised £268.53 for the ward. Cilcain also suffered the awful loss of a great friend of many of the club’s members, Gareth Williams. The money raised at the Cilcain Show from the clubs slippery pole stand and our Summer BBQ came to £260.12 in total which was donated to the Williams family to donate to a charity of their choice.The club has taken part in a range of stock judging and public speaking competitions in the past 12 months with Anna Hickie-Roberts going down to Brecon to represent Cilcain after her success in the 16 and Under English Public Speaking competition where she came joint first and was chosen the best chair speaker. Dafydd Williams also received the well earned Junior Member of the year award from the county. The Cilcain lads also came flying through the finish line in first place on the Raft Race in Wrexham on their sturdy, streamlined raft! So no matter what it is, Cilcain YFC are always willing to give it a good go! Well on one condition...they can go to the pub after it!!
